Anjali Anand was born in Mumbai, Maharashtra. She is the daughter of former actor Dinesh Anand. Anjali has always had a passion for acting. She frequently went with her father when he went to shoots.

The 2017 web series ‘Untag’ marked Anjali’s professional debut. With the 2017 television series Dhhai Kilo Prem, Anjali gained popularity. She played the part of Dipika Piyush Sharma in the television series. Following this episode, she played a lead character in the Star Plus series Kulfi Kumar Bajewala. She played the role of Loveleen Gill, the mother of the title character. Now, Anjali is preparing herself for her Bollywood debut in Alia Bhatt and Ranveer Singh starrer Rocky Aur Rani Ki Prem Kahaani

When the news came out that Anjali Anand will be one of the confirmed contestants in Khatron Ke Khiladi 13, she was heavily trolled on social media and was body shamed. “Weight to Kam Karo madam”, “Ye khatron ke khiladi mein jaake kya karegi” are some of the comments that can be often seen written on her posts. Referring to this, Anjali said in an interview, “I laugh after reading the comments. I don’t pay attention to trolls. Although, earlier I used to hate their words, now I don’t. I keep reading such comments and laugh it off. I have taken many solo adventurous trips, but at the same time, I feel I am not answerable to anyone when I am already a part of the show.”
